VIENNA, Austria – December 15th, 2008
Bplus, independent software developer, today announces the launch of the official website to Niki – Rock ‘n’ Ball, its upcoming arcade platformer, available on WiiWare™ soon.
What is a ZeLeLi pearl?
How does the Amulet work?
Where do all the monsters come from?
Who is Niki?This and more is revealed on the website together with an exclusive new video that illustrates the intriguing story of Niki – Rock ‘n’ Ball.
The website offers many new screenshots as well as detailed information about how the game can be played and introduces not only the hero Niki but also the Turbofan, the Bumper and some of the monsters Niki has to fight in his first adventure.

Gaming Community Responds to Economic Downturn with Bids on Songs of Awesomeness
SEATTLE – Dec. 12, 2008 – The fifth annual Child’s Play Charity dinner auction held on Tuesday night netted over $200,000 in contributions, as a sold-out crowd of over 400 video game industry leaders and community enthusiasts crowded into the Washington State Convention and Trade Center’s sky bridge to bid on more than 100 lots of gaming memorabilia to support sick children in more than 60 hospitals around the world. Tuesday night’s passion for charitable giving pushes the current running total for 2008 to $1.07 million, handily surpassing the stated goal of $750,000 for this year’s drive.
